What are the typical daily tasks and responsibilities for someone with no experience working at a horse ranch during the summer?

For those starting at a horse ranch with no prior experience, daily tasks often include feeding and watering horses, cleaning stalls, maintaining the barn area, and assisting with routine care such as grooming. You may also help with general ranch chores like fence repair, tack cleaning, or guiding visitors under supervision. Most ranches provide on-the-job training, and teamwork is crucial, as you'll work closely with experienced staff and other seasonal workers to ensure the animals' well-being and smooth ranch operations.

What is a summer no experience horse ranch job?

A Summer No Experience Horse Ranch job is a seasonal position at a horse ranch specifically designed for individuals with little to no prior experience working with horses or on ranches. These jobs typically involve assisting with basic horse care, ranch maintenance, and sometimes helping with guest activities. They provide on-the-job training and are ideal for those looking to learn about horses, ranch work, and rural life. Many ranches hire students or young adults for these positions during the busy summer months. It's a great opportunity to gain new skills, work outdoors, and experience ranch life firsthand.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in a summer no experience horse ranch position, and why are they important?

To thrive in a summer horse ranch role with no prior experience, you need a willingness to learn, physical stamina, and a genuine interest in working with animals. Basic familiarity with ranch safety protocols and the ability to follow instructions are important, though most technical skills are learned on the job. Dependability, teamwork, and a positive attitude help you adapt to new tasks and build strong relationships with coworkers and animals. These qualities ensure you can contribute effectively to ranch operations, maintain safety, and create a positive environment for both staff and horses.
